A Theory of Crash Rate for Private & Public Projects with Critical or non-Critical systems. Analyzing & managing risk has been a quest for 5000 years, and is essential to everything from water supplies, finance, and agriculture to computers and space travel. At last there is a quantitative theory and a simple equation that allows you to: - choose your failure rate - get there optimally - avoid unexpected effects - profit where the competition fails Work a project example based on real-world data to manage the risk of a for-profit 10-passenger transport to an orbital tourism facility. Examine possibilities for managing the crash rate of countries and even the world.

About the Author
Robert Shuler combines 42 years of experience in aerospace & software fault tolerant systems design, verification and management with 50 years investing experience and a knack for finding hidden principles. He has half a dozen patents and numerous publications in fields ranging from economics (corporate risk compensation, the equity premium) to physics (inertia & quantum gravity). He lives in Texas with his wife Natasha, and has written books on The Equity Premium Puzzle and Money, Wealth & War.
